The Fruits of the Spirit Quiz for Kids

The Fruits of the Spirit are nine beautiful qualities that God wants to grow in our hearts when we follow Jesus. These are found in Galatians 5:22-23 and include love, joy, peace, patience, kindness, goodness, faithfulness, gentleness, and self-control. Learning about these fruits helps us understand what it means to live as a Christian and treat others with God's love. Can you name them all?

Frequently Asked Questions

What exactly are the Fruits of the Spirit?+
The Fruits of the Spirit are nine beautiful character qualities that the Holy Spirit develops in Christians' hearts when they follow Jesus. They are listed in Galatians 5:22-23 and include love, joy, peace, patience, kindness, goodness, faithfulness, gentleness, and self-control. These fruits show what it looks like to live like Jesus and treat others with God's love.
Why are they called 'fruits'?+
They're called 'fruits' because just like fruit grows on a tree when it's healthy and has good roots, these character qualities grow in our hearts when we're connected to Jesus and the Holy Spirit. We don't create them by ourselves—they grow naturally in us as we follow God, just like how God makes fruit grow on trees.
Can kids develop the Fruits of the Spirit?+
Yes! The Fruits of the Spirit can start growing in kids' hearts at any age when they follow Jesus. While we all grow and mature, even children can show love, kindness, patience, and the other fruits in how they treat family, friends, and others. As you get older, these fruits continue to develop more and more in your life.
